Chrome quality sucks...plain and simple. A piece of chrome about one sq. inch was flaking off when I took the rims out of the box brand new. The part wasn't noticeable though b/c it was inside the rim, but still that's ridiculous for brand new wheels. Now after a couple of months my chrome is starting to pit a little in some areas.
As far as fitment and vibrations they are spot on, no problems. Fit great, but require BFH mod if you are lowered like me. Hope that helps.
Edit: Added a pic for reference.
I called AFS to try to remedy the problem and got EXCEPTIONAL treatment from them. They were more than happy to try to get the problem resolved. All they asked me for were some digital pics showing them what was going on.
After they got the messages and pictures, they sent me a brand new set of four rims. Apparently, they had a bad batch of clearcoat get on some of the wheels and I got sent some that weren't supposed to go out at all.
Fast forward to the new set. They have been on for almost five months and I don't have any problems at all. They had great service and I would recommend them.
